Subject:                                          Adopt Resolution Authorizing and Directing the Chair of the Board of Supervisors to Execute Annual Federal Apportionment Exchange Program and State Match Program Agreements with the State of California, Department of Transportation, Agreement No. X25-5914(137)

 

 

Executive Summary:

 

On March 21, 2025, the California Department of Transportation (Caltrans) notified the County of the opportunity to participate in the Optional Federal Exchange and State Match Program for FFY 2024/2025. The exchange amount is based on the County’s estimated FFY 2025 apportionments. 

 

On an annual basis, the County has exchanged the Federal transportation funds for unrestricted State dollars which provide greater flexibility on the type and location of projects to be funded. The County continues to meet the criteria to exchange the 2024/2025 apportionments. 

 

Caltrans has forwarded the Federal Apportionment Exchange and State Match Program Agreement for the County of Lake, which allows for the exchange of these funds.

 

The California Department of Transportation (Caltrans) requires the Board of Supervisors to adopt a resolution authorizing who may sign the agreement for the County.
